Sha256: 0e011d2bce3425de665253758662ca8b25c6611383bc9005a0c6cb7bb28a1114

Contents?: true

Size: 399 Bytes

Versions: 8

Compression:

Stored size: 399 Bytes

Contents

// 'Polyfill' for :placeholder-shown, since it's not standard yet

$(document).on('focus focusout', '.zuo-textbox', function(e) {
  $("label[for='" + $(this).attr('id') + "']").toggleClass('floating', $(this).val() !== "");
});

$(document).on('change.select2', 'select', function(e) {
  $("label[for='" + $(this).attr('id') + "']").toggleClass('floating', !['', null].includes($(this).val()));
});

Version data entries

8 entries across 8 versions & 1 rubygems

Version Path
zuora_connect_ui-0.2.10 app/assets/javascripts/zuora_connect_ui/input.js
zuora_connect_ui-0.2.9 app/assets/javascripts/zuora_connect_ui/input.js
zuora_connect_ui-0.2.8 app/assets/javascripts/zuora_connect_ui/input.js
zuora_connect_ui-0.2.7 app/assets/javascripts/zuora_connect_ui/input.js
zuora_connect_ui-0.2.6 app/assets/javascripts/zuora_connect_ui/input.js
zuora_connect_ui-0.2.5 app/assets/javascripts/zuora_connect_ui/input.js
zuora_connect_ui-0.2.4 app/assets/javascripts/zuora_connect_ui/input.js
zuora_connect_ui-0.2.3 app/assets/javascripts/zuora_connect_ui/input.js